Heat off your own timber
Fairview is one of the truest wood-heat towns we serve — wooded rural lots, steady stove and insert demand, and many homes on propane rather than a gas main. That combination is why wood pays: a cord cut and seasoned off your own land is heat you own outright — no delivery truck, no meter reading — and it beats delivered propane on cost per BTU. Burn it in a modern EPA stove like the Regency Cascades F1500 — about 78% efficient, up to 1,500 square feet — and each log does the work of several in an open fireplace.
Creosote is the real cost
Here's the Fairview catch that turns cheap heat expensive if you ignore it: creosote buildup is the leading cause of chimney fires in these parts, and it comes from burning green wood and skipping fall sweeps. Season your wood a full year, store it dry, and book a professional sweep and inspection every year to CSIA and NFPA standards — that fixed cost is small next to a flue fire, and it's what keeps wood heat genuinely economical.
